BACKPORT: zram: remove waitqueue for IO done
zram_reset_device() waits for ongoing writepage pages to be completed by zram->refcount logic. However, it's pointless because before the reset, we prevent further opening of zram by zram->claim and flush all of pending IO by fsync_bdev so there should be no pending IO at the zram_reset_device(). So let's remove that code which is even broken due to the lack of wake_up elsewhere.
